KIM PATRICIA BERG is a founding partner of Gould & Berg, LLP. Throughout her career she has focused her practice in the area of employment law, discrimination, retaliation, civil rights, and commercial litigation.. Ms. Berg’s representation of both employees and employers provides her with a unique and well-rounded perspective toward employment disputes and litigated matters. She routinely pursues and defends claims before administrative agencies such as the EEOC, New York State Division of Human Rights and Westchester County Human Rights Commission as well as before the trial and appellate courts in the state and federal courts throughout New York. She has successfully tried and resolved through settlement countless cases throughout her career. Her success at trial in a complex prisoner death case won her accolades for the highest verdict in a civil rights case as reported by Verdict Searches “Top NY Verdicts for 2009” and she has been named to the New York Super Lawyer’s list.. In addition to litigation, Ms. Berg regularly provides advice and consult to employees and employers in a variety of employment matters, including analyzing the particular issue to determine options for resolution, developing strategies for easing a difficult work environment or dealing with a difficult employee, exploring the possibility of resolution out of court, mediating disputes in the workplace, and drafting, reviewing and negotiating severance agreements. As part of her practice, Ms. Berg also provides advice to employers for the creation and implementation of appropriate anti-discrimination policies and reporting procedures, including conducting training seminars on behalf of companies. She has developed and presented numerous continuing legal education seminars on both procedural and substantive matters involving her areas of practice.. Kelly has been practicing law for 23 years and has brought more than 25 cases to jury verdicts with a greater than 90% success rate. She is passionate about creating equal opportunities in the workplace and is determined to fight for all employees. In addition, Kelly is a Board Advisor for the Albany Therapeutic Riding Center— a nonprofit organization that provides equine programs for people with physical and emotional disabilities. Kelly also volunteers with The Legal Project dedicating her time to the legal needs of the most vulnerable members of the Capital Region.. Over the last decade, Kelly has developed a practice focused on employment law. Her caseload has included representing employees that have experienced discrimination, sexual harassment, USERRA violations, and NYS and federal wage and hour violations. Her cases are filed in both federal and state courts in New York State as well as with the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C), The New York Division of Human Rights (NYSDHR), the National Labor Relations Board (NLRB), and the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(“OSHA”). Kelly is proud to have worked with multiple female law enforcement officers fighting to shatter some of the thickest glass ceilings in the public workforce.

Justin Heiferman spent nearly 20 years managing complex financial audits and investigations, both as an attorney and as a banker, for noteworthy institutions including JP Morgan Chase, BDO Seidman and Credit Suisse First Boston. As a former Assistant District Attorney with the Nassau County District Attorney Economic Crimes Bureau, Justin prosecuted and managed numerous complex investigations including Identity Theft, Mortgage Fraud, Bank Fraud and various other larcenies and frauds, working in conjunction with elite law enforcement agencies including FBI, Secret Service, USPIS, NY State Police, PA/PD, NYPD, and MTA. After the DA's office, Justin furthered his skills while practicing employment litigation for one of the largest labor and employment law firms in the US.. Recent successes:. Immigration: successfully obtained O Visa for Canadian Film Director who directed music videos for artists including Selena Gomez, Justin Bieber, Rihanna, Pharrell Williams and N.E.R.D. Obtained H-1B for NYU/Columbia MBA grads from China, as well as Film Producer from Norway.. Criminal: full dismissal of charges for a client accused of million-dollar eel theft, full dismissal of charges for multiple felony drug clients who successfully completed intensive, TASC-rehabilitation programs, dismissal of all criminal charges for multiple clients arrested for cigarette trafficking, dismissal of all criminal charges for clients arrested for trademark counterfeiting, non-jail sentence for a client accused of embezzling over $600,000. Assisted multiple domestic violence clients and victims with court-monitored therapy programs, resulting in dismissal of criminal charges.. Employment: successfully defended film producer in obtaining dismissal of FLSA lawsuit alleging violations of overtime and minimum wage. Successfully negotiated settlements, after filing federal lawsuits on behalf of restaurant and nail-salon employees alleging state and federal minimum wage and overtime violations..
